Review – Wallace Berrie Star Wars rings

For Empire Strikes Back, the Star Wars jewelry license was held by Wallace Berrie. Their line included pendants, pins, and a set of six adjustable rings which I have recently been able to add to my own collection. Each ring is gold in color, with an adjustable band. The packaging…

Review – Weingeroff 1977 necklaces

My first vintage Star Wars purchase for my wardrobe was the R2-D2 and C-3PO necklaces made by Weingeroff Ent. Providence, R.I. (licensed by Factors Etc, Inc) in 1977. They are amongst the first ever Star Wars merchandise – they feature the 20th Century Fox copyright details, with no mention of Lucasfilm. They were made in…
